Background:
UNESCO works to protect and promote Ukraine’s cultural heritage, support creative industries, and strengthen cultural policies in response to the ongoing war. Effective communication is essential to ensure visibility of results, strengthen partnerships, and engage the public. The Communications Consultant – Culture Sector will provide dedicated communications support for UNESCO’s culture-related activities, ensuring high-quality, timely, and impactful content across multiple platforms.
Objective of the Assignment:
To develop and implement communications activities that highlight UNESCO’s cultural projects in Ukraine, in line with UNESCO’s global communication standards and under the supervision of the Head of Communications and in close coordination with the Head of the Culture team and the Culture team of UNESCO Antenna in Ukraine.

Deliverables:
• At least one article or success story per month on culture activities;
• Regularly drafted and published social media content (at least 1 piece of content every week for each UNESCO’s platform – X, Facebook, potentially Instagram);
• Photo and video packages from culture-related events and field visits;
• Monthly communications update/report for the culture sector.
Education:
• University degree in communications, journalism, public relations, media studies, international relations, cultural studies, or related field.
Experience:
• At least 5 years of progressively responsible experience in communications, journalism, or public information, preferably in the cultural sector or with international organizations;
• Proven experience in content writing, including scripts for the production of videos materials;
• Experience managing social media platforms for organizations.
Skills and Competencies:
• Strong writing and editing skills in Ukrainian and English;
• Strong organizational and coordination abilities;
• Ability to work under tight deadlines and manage multiple tasks;
• Ability to travel within Ukraine;
• Creativity, attention to detail, and ability to adapt to evolving priorities.
Languages:
• Excellent command of Ukrainian and English (oral and written).
Experience in photography and video production, with basic editing skills.
